IP查询
查询
你查询的IP:[119.128.142.217] 地理位置:中国–广东–东莞
最新查询
210.5.45.73
222.176.98.125
222.240.239.24
118.228.205.217
123.56.28.6
58.100.30.169
119.19.39.241
125.64.145.202
203.196.53.195
118.239.158.96
119.128.142.217
210.25.188.211
210.15.97.146
221.200.155.184
125.61.128.65
134.196.68.205
125.64.153.117
123.49.128.208
59.191.82.54
118.88.64.168
119.62.207.223
116.224.181.226
203.90.192.149
202.38.152.152
123.99.128.0
117.53.48.109
202.38.128.227
221.199.224.221
123.112.62.171
58.68.128.216
116.199.115.168
117.40.197.223